Leonard Coleman was the NL president from 1994-1999. That may help narrow it down. It seems pretty clear that the top autograph begins with a "K." Here's a list of players through the years whose first name starts with that letter (I don't know if it's complete). To me, the last name looks as though it starts with an "F." I was thinking maybe Keith Foulke, as he was with the Giants in '97. But that doesn't seem to be a match. OK. Galarraga is a bit inconsistent with his signature, but this one looks pretty good. So it appears to be Keith Lockhart and Andres Galarraga, and we can narrow it down to the 1998 Braves, as that's the only season they were teammates when the Coleman ball was in use. Nice job, Steve D!
